First things first, let's talk about what a VDA Li-ion battery is. The VDA, which is a group for automobile manufacturers, sets the specifications for things like battery dimensions, and they've got their own standard for electric vehicle batteries, the VDA Li-ion battery.
It's a rechargeable battery, mostly used in electric vehicles, and it's really skilled at storing energy and durable over time. The VDA says these batteries are required to last about 10 years duration with proper maintenance.
Picking the right battery for your electric vehicle might appear challenging, but it's super critical for your car to function properly and ensure safety. You gotta think about things like how many energy the battery holds, how strong it is, and frequency you can charge it.
The storage capability tells you how far your car can travel on one recharge, and the voltage is like the energy rating of your battery. And by 'charge-discharge cycles,' they mean how many times you can recharge and operate it before the battery starts to travel downhill. You should really look at your car's operater guide or consult a expert to make sure you choose the correct model for your car.

Ensuring your battery stays healthy is critical to making sure it functions well and doesn't cost you a fortune. Here are some methods for maintaining your battery's good condition:
First up, Avoid allowing your battery to fully discharge or overcharge. Maintain a 20-80% charge level to keep it in good shape.
Ensure you regularly charge your battery so it doesn't degrade or fail.
Acquire a quality charger—it'll help keep your battery in great shape and ensure it's properly charged.
If you plan to leave your car unused for an extended period, just charge it to around 50% and store it in a cool, dry place.
